Gravel biking around Blotzheim offers a diverse landscape characterized by a mix of open fields, wooded sections, and paths alongside waterways like the Canal de Huningue. The region features gentle rolling hills, providing varied terrain for gravel cyclists. Elevations are generally moderate, with some routes offering views of the surrounding countryside and distant urban centers.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many gravel bike trails are available around Blotzheim?

There are over 270 gravel bike trails around Blotzheim, offering a wide range of options for different skill levels and preferences. The region is well-regarded by the komoot community, with an average rating of 4.5 stars from nearly 600 reviews.

Are there any easy gravel bike trails suitable for beginners or families in Blotzheim?

Yes, Blotzheim offers several easier routes. For a more relaxed ride, consider the Kembs Dam – Istein Rapids loop from Saint-Louis La Chaussée. This moderate 23.4-mile (37.7 km) route features minimal elevation gain, making it suitable for those looking for a less strenuous experience.

What kind of views can I expect on gravel bike routes in Blotzheim?

Many routes in Blotzheim offer diverse views. You can find expansive vistas across green, hilly landscapes, as well as views towards nearby urban centers like Basel. For example, the View of Basel and Roche Towers – Glox Picnic and Barbecue Area loop from Hégenheim provides clear views of Basel and its distinctive Roche Towers.

Are there any circular gravel bike routes around Blotzheim?

Yes, many of the gravel bike routes in Blotzheim are circular, allowing you to start and end at the same point. An example is the Canal de Huningue – Hégenheim - Hagenthal cycle path loop from Bartenheim, which is a moderate 22.8-mile (36.7 km) loop.

What are some challenging gravel bike routes in the Blotzheim area?

For those seeking a challenge, Blotzheim has over 150 difficult routes. A notable option is the Beautiful view – Beautiful, green hilly landscape loop from Hégenheim. This difficult 30.8-mile (49.6 km) path features significant elevation changes and offers expansive views across a green, hilly landscape.

What natural attractions or landmarks can I see along the gravel bike trails?

The region offers several points of interest. You might encounter the Istein Rapids, a natural river feature, or cycle along the Wiesendamm promenade. The Lange Erlen Park and Wiese River also provide scenic natural settings for your ride.

What is the best time of year for gravel biking in Blotzheim?

Gravel biking in Blotzheim is enjoyable throughout much of the year. The diverse landscape of open fields and wooded sections means conditions can vary. Spring and autumn generally offer pleasant temperatures and vibrant scenery, while summer can be great for longer days. Winter riding is possible, but be prepared for potentially colder and wetter conditions, especially on unpaved sections.

Are there any routes that pass by cafes or places to stop for refreshments?

While specific cafes on every route are not detailed, many routes pass through or near villages and towns where you can find refreshment stops. The region's mix of urban proximity and rural paths means opportunities for breaks are usually available, especially on routes that skirt populated areas or follow canal paths.

What are the typical terrain conditions for gravel biking in Blotzheim?

The terrain around Blotzheim is varied, characterized by a mix of open fields, wooded sections, and paths alongside waterways like the Canal de Huningue. You'll encounter gentle rolling hills, providing a dynamic riding experience. Surfaces typically include gravel paths, compacted dirt, and some paved sections connecting different areas.
